Ain Ben Tili 004 25.46857 N, 10.13846 W
Tiris Zemmour, Mauritania
Find: 2022
Classification: Ungrouped achondrite
The meteorite was found in 2022 in northern Mauritania and was subsequently purchased by Mohamed Ali Loud from Alian Muftah at the 2024 Munich mineral fair.
Physical characteristics: Many light grayish fragments, some of which are partly covered with black fusion crust.
Petrography: Achondritic breccia composed of a wide variety of up to 7 mm-sized euhedral to subhedral mineral fragments in a fine-grained cataclastic matrix of related material. The most abundant are compositionally homogeneous olivine (about 85 vol%), exsolved pyroxene (about 8 vol%), and feldspar (about 2 vol%) grains. Zoned olivines are rare. Accessories (about 5 vol%) include silica, chromite, FeS, kamacite, and taenite. Contains augite-chromite symplectites.
Geochemistry: compositions of individual olivine grains: Fa14.4±0.1, FeO/MnO=39±2, n=7; Fa17.2±0.1, FeO/MnO=39±2, n=7; Fa20.4±0.1, FeO/MnO=40±2, n=7; Fa36.0±0.2, FeO/MnO=46±3, n=7; zoned olivine: Fa10.8±1.0 (Fa10.1-12.7), FeO/MnO=39±3, n=7; Ca-pyroxene in symplectites: Fs5.4±0.1, Wo45.2±0.2, FeO/MnO=14±2, n=7; low-Ca pyroxene hosting exsolution lamellae: Fs31.6±0.1, Wo3.1±0.1 (Fs31.5-31.8, Wo3.0-3.1), FeO/MnO=26-29, n=7; Ca-pyroxene exsolution lamellae: Fs14.4±0.3, Wo42.4±0.2 (Fs13.8-14.7, Wo42.2-42.6), FeO/MnO=21-24, n=7; feldspar: An63.8-65.0, Ab33.6-34.9, Or1.3-1.5, n=7; chromite: Mg#31.4±2.8, Cr#75.1±1.9, n=10.
Classification: Ungrouped achondrite, dunitic breccia. Likely paired with NWA 15717 and related meteorites.
Shock stage: low
Weathering grade: low
Classifier: A. Greshake, MNB.
